MASTERDRIVE Leasing and Rental has won a contract to supply vehicles to national charity United Response. The Putney-based charity, which provides residential and day care for people with learning difficulties and mental health problems, operates a mixed 120-vehicle fleet including small saloon cars, MPVs, vans and minibuses.

It has previously bought vehicles outright and dealt with all its own maintenance issues. However, in a solus deal Masterdrive will now provide 'used qualifying vehicles', with minimal previous mileage, with extended warranty benefits and delivery within 14 days.

So far vehicles supplied include Peugeot 406 and Citroen Xantia under four-year contract hire agreements with full maintenance. The intention is to extend contract hire throughout the fleet as further vehicles come up for replacement.
